Economic Development Dynamics in Asir: An Analysis Based on Economic Indicators and Saudi Vision 2030

This study analyzes the economic development dynamics of the Asir region within the framework of Saudi Vision 2030, focusing on sectoral indicators and structural transformation. Using a descriptive-analytical approach supported by both quantitative and qualitative methods, it evaluates key sectors such as tourism, entertainment, education, health, real estate, and air transport, linking them to spatial and regional development policies. Findings highlight tourism as a major driver, with over 7.8 million overnight visitors, spending exceeding 11.4 billion riyals, and more than 70.6 million nights, underscoring its role in boosting local income and service activities. Strong education and health infrastructure- over 465,000 students, 41 hospitals, and 274 healthcare centers- supports productivity and stability. Air transport expanded significantly after the development of Abha International Airport, serving 3.9 million passengers in 2023, enhancing connectivity and investment. Real estate indicators reveal dominance of agricultural transactions alongside gradual growth in residential and commercial activity, signaling a reshaping of land use and economic functions.Downloads
